Paper air filter cartridges should be cleaned by:

  1. Blowing with air

  2. Hosing down

  3. Scraping

  4. Tapping lightly on a hard surface

The correct answer is: Blowing with air

Paper air filter cartridges should be cleaned by blowing with air because it is a gentle method that helps to remove excess dirt and debris without damaging the filter itself. Blowing with air allows for a quick and effective way to clear out any built-up particles from the filter, ensuring that the engine receives clean and sufficient air flow for optimal performance. Hosing down, scraping, or tapping lightly on a hard surface can potentially tear or damage the paper filter, reducing its effectiveness and leading to potential engine issues.
